Petite note aux modos:
Se serait pas mieux de re-ouvrir un topic pour les debats sur les idees histoire de garder celui-ci clean (juste les idees) ?
Merci
Petite note aux modos:
Se serait pas mieux de re-ouvrir un topic pour les debats sur les idees histoire de garder celui-ci clean (juste les idees) ?
Merci
Une vraie base en cluster, avec une vraie reprise en bascule...
Le retour des dbcc de la version 4 (ceux permettant, entre autre, de recréer le chaînage de page manuellement en cas de grosse casse)
Sr DBA Oracle / MS-SQL / MySQL / Postgresql / SAP-Sybase / Informix / DB2
N'oublie pas de consulter mes articles, mon blog, les cours et les FAQ SGBD
Attention : pas de réponse technique par MP : pensez aux autres, passez par les forums !
C'est prévu. On attendait juste que le topic grandisse un peu.Petite note aux modos:
Se serait pas mieux de re-ouvrir un topic pour les debats sur les idees histoire de garder celui-ci clean (juste les idees) ?
Merci
Salut Fadace. Tu peux préciser un peu également ?Une vraie base en cluster, avec une vraie reprise en bascule...
++
Allez alors, dans ce cas la, je rajoute une suggestion:
Etat actuel:
- Actuellement une policy verifie la validite d'une et unique condition.
- Actuellement, une condition a pour scope une et unique facette.
Etat souhaite:
- Pouvoir en une policy verifier plusieures facettes
Solutions proposees:
- Une policy pouvant verifier 1 a n conditions
- Une condition pouvant contenir des elements a verifier de 1 a n facette
- Les 2 solutions proposees ci-dessus combinees (ce qui permet a l'utilisateur de choisir lui meme comment il veut implementer cela)
Une autre idee qui me passe par la tete:
Un systeme d'auto-maintenance pour le partitionning.
L'idee serait de pouvoir sur base de fonctions/triggers - gerer automatiquement l'ajout de filegroup - datafile et l'update automatique des partition function et partition schema selon une logique predefinie.
Exemple:
- Un partition function qui se base sur une valeur YYYYMM (year-month), a l'arrivee d'une valeur encore inconnue, creation d'un nouveau filegroup/datafile pour tout les schemas se basant sur cette fonction de partition.
Mise a jour de la fonction de partition/Mise a jour du mapping des schema sous-jacent.
Le provisionning d'axes physiques ne se fait en général pas automatiquement je ne vois pas comment automiser ce genre de choses. Personnellement je trouve que le partitionnement sur des grosses volumétries se prépare et se planifie avec les protagonistes concernés.Un systeme d'auto-maintenance pour le partitionning.
L'idee serait de pouvoir sur base de fonctions/triggers - gerer automatiquement l'ajout de filegroup - datafile et l'update automatique des partition function et partition schema selon une logique predefinie.
Ta réflexion sur les policy est intéressante, je répondrais un peu plus tard :-)Etat actuel:
- Actuellement une policy verifie la validite d'une et unique condition.
- Actuellement, une condition a pour scope une et unique facette.
Etat souhaite:
- Pouvoir en une policy verifier plusieures facettes
Solutions proposees:
- Une policy pouvant verifier 1 a n conditions
- Une condition pouvant contenir des elements a verifier de 1 a n facette
- Les 2 solutions proposees ci-dessus combinees (ce qui permet a l'utilisateur de choisir lui meme comment il veut implementer cela)
++
Effectivement et a ce niveau la SQL Serveur ne peux pas aider.
Par contre le seul boulot qu'il reste au DBA est de s'assurer d'avoir les disques deja creer a l'avance.
Il est assez facile de prevoir des mount points:
201101
201102
...
Volontier !
Je sais qu'il est possible de faire des fonctions et toutes sortes de choses qui sont surement plus avancees que ce qui est propose out-of-the-box facilement accessible en click and go.
L'idee ici serait d'avoir une policy qui se configure un peu comme un job SQL:
- Condition 1
- Condition 2
...
Je pense que Microsoft n'implémentera pas ce genre de choses dans le futur ou du moins pas sous cette forme. Effectivement on ne peut pas implémenter 1 condition avec 2 facettes différentes.Je sais qu'il est possible de faire des fonctions et toutes sortes de choses qui sont surement plus avancees que ce qui est propose out-of-the-box facilement accessible en click and go.
L'idee ici serait d'avoir une policy qui se configure un peu comme un job SQL:
- Condition 1
- Condition 2
Cf https://connect.microsoft.com/SQLSer...ion-per-policy
++
encore plus basique: je rêve d'une gestion meilleure des requêtes imbriquées.
(allocation mémoire et temps d’exécution)
Il va falloir détailler un peu ce que vous reprochez à SQL SERVER à ce niveau?encore plus basique: je rêve d'une gestion meilleure des requêtes imbriquées.
(allocation mémoire et temps d’exécution)
Prendre conscience, c'est transformer le voile qui recouvre la lumière en miroir.
MCTS Database Development
MCTS Database Administration
J'ai pas relu tout le topic, ca a peut etre ete deja dit:
BIDS en version 64 bits !
Je souhaiterais que MS ajoute la possibilite de declarer un type de donnees mappe au type de la table sous jacente comme sous oracle.
des lors une procedure pourrais declarer des parametres d'une maniere plus lisible :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 create table t_matable ( id int not null, value1 varchar(20) )
ca vous evite de memoriser le type de chaque champs. Je trouve ca pas mal.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 create procedure proc_maprocedure ( @id id%type; @value1 value1%type ) as ****
Pour ma part une DMV, DMF peut importe qui pourrait récupérer l'espace disque utilisé et libre pour les mount point.
++
Si jamais, en powershell (tailles en GB):
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 foreach($volume in gwmi -Class win32_volume) {$Capacity = $volume.capacity/1073741824; $freeSpace= $volume.freespace/1073741824; $used = $Capacity - $freeSpace; write-host $volume.name ' - Capacity:' $Capacity ' - Free space:' $freespace ' - Used:' $used }
En powershell oui avec WMI . J'utilise également ce genre de script. Cependant ca serait tellement bien qu'on puisse avoir le même genre d'informations que xp_fixeddrives par exemple ... ou avec une DMV peu importe poour tout ce qui concerne SQL Server .. et pendant qu'on y est que ce soit la même chose pour les Policy-Based Management .. vu qu'on peut pas récupérer les informations d'espace utilisés quand il s'agit des mount point.
PS : En passant tu devrais faire un billet de ton script. Ca pourrait servir à pas mal de personnes.
++
Voila, avec quelques variantes...
http://blog.developpez.com/dje/p1058...capacite-de-1/
Je vérifie demain si le drive type des mount points pour corriger si besoin, j'ai pas de ca chez moi (ne pas les filtrer dehors).
Pour moi il manque un vrai système de sysprep car actuellement, on ne gagne pas "énormément" de temps en préparant une instance. Il est quasiement aussi rapide de scripter une install et la déployer par vtom ou $u.
Ca serait pas mal de pouvoir cloner un machine virtuelle avec SQL Server déjà installé et qu'un sysprep permette réellement de refaire la config (comme pour Windows)
Pouvez-vous donner un peu plus de details ?
Et bien il n'est pas possible de cloner une VM avec un SQL Server déjà installé. Donc le seul moyen pour déployer des SQL Server a la volée est de déployer le middleware en post config, ce qui prend quand même un certain temps si on install la totalité des features.
Alors que le sysprep premet de faire ça au niveau OS, ça serait bien que l'on puisse faire de même avec les middlewares.
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ager